Dramatic CCTV footage has been released of a policeman repeatedly punching a suspected
shoplifter in the face.
Sarah Reed was sitting in a chair in the back of a central London clothing shop when PC
James Kiddie launched towards her, grabbing her hair and dragging her across the floor
and then punching her three times in the head.
He can be seen leaning on her neck as he waits for back up to arrive.
Kiddie told the courts today that he went to search her bag, and she bit him on the
finger and claimed that she had the AIDS virus.
He's has been dismissed from the Metropolitan Police and was found guilty of common assault.
Kiddie was spared jail but was sentenced to 150 hours of community services and told to
pay £500 in prosecution costs and a £60 victim surcharge.
